Phosphorylated GM130 is stored at ERES during maturation. Oocytes were stained for GM130 (green), P-GM130 (red), and DNA (blue) at different maturation stages. (A-C) 0 h GV stage oocyte containing a perinuclear Golgi apparatus (arrowhead). (D-F) 24 h matured MI oocyte containing a metaphase plate (arrowhead). (G-I) 44 h matured MII oocyte showing the second metaphase plate (arrowhead) and a polar body (yellow arrowhead). Arrows indicate the area that is shown enlarged in the insets. Z-projections of 3 (A-F) or 6 (G-I) consecutive sections are shown; scale bars represent 20 μm in C, F and I, and 5 μm in C' F' and I'. Arrows indicate the region of the oocyte that is shown enlarged in the insets (A'-I'). (J) Weighted mean percentage ± weighted SEM of oocytes that contain a P-GM130-labeled cortical domain at the indicated maturation times. Results from 2 independent experiments are shown.
